3 Easy Websites for Translating Biblical Hebrew to English
If you are looking for a way to translate Biblical Hebrew to English, there are several websites that can help. Here are three of the best:
- Bible Hub – Bible Hub is an online Bible study suite that includes a variety of tools and resources. One of these resources is an interlinear Bible, which provides a word-for-word translation of the Hebrew text.
- Chabad.org – Chabad.org is a website that provides a wide range of Jewish content. They offer a Hebrew-English translation tool that allows users to translate words and phrases from Hebrew to English.
- Hebrew Online – Hebrew Online is a website that offers a free Hebrew course for beginners. The course includes lessons on Hebrew grammar, vocabulary, and pronunciation. They also provide a Hebrew-English dictionary that can be useful for translating the Bible.
